Are Toyotas expensive to insure?

Insuring a Toyota costs an average of $1,226 annually. This premium is lower than average compared to other makes and models. MoneyGeek broke down auto insurance costs for major Toyota models by model year and driver age to help drivers find the best option for them.

How much does insurance on a supra cost?

Toyota Supra car insurance rates average $1,676 per year (about $140 per month) for full coverage, but can vary based on deductibles and limits. The cheapest Supra to insure is the 2.0 Coupe model at an estimated $1,632 per year. The most expensive is the 3.0 Premium Coupe at $1,720 annually.

How much is a car insurance for GR86?

Toyota GR86 insurance costs an average of $1,764 per year for a full coverage policy, depending on policy limits. The cheapest GR86 insurance is on the base Coupe at around $1,748 per year, with the Premium Coupe costing $1,782 annually.

How much is insurance a month for a Lambo?

Lamborghinis usually need more than just liability coverage, so be prepared to pay more for comprehensive and collision coverage. On average, it costs between $10,000 to $30,000 per year, or $833 to $2,500 per month, to insure a Lamborghini.

Are supercars expensive to insure?

Make no mistake, insuring an exotic car is certainly expensive. Expect to pay several thousand dollars per year to insure most production supercar models.

Is it cheaper to insure a Honda or Toyota?

According to our data, insurance premiums on Toyotas are a little cheaper than Hondas. The average annual premium for a Toyota is $2,616, while for Hondas it is $2,800.

Is insurance on BRZ high?

MoneyGeek found that the average cost of insurance for a Subaru BRZ is $1,495 per year. Although this cost is not as high as BMWs, Teslas and other luxury cars, the model is moderately more expensive to insure than other models. The Subaru BRZ insurance cost is a bit higher than the average of all car models.

How much is it to insure a Supra 2021?

We pulled car insurance quotes from top insurance companies to find that the average monthly cost to insure a 2021 Toyota Supra is $224.75 — or $2,697 a year.

How much should I pay for a Supra?

The 2022 Toyota Supra has a $43,190 starting price, which is considerably less than any other vehicle in the class. The price bumps up to $51,540 for six-cylinder models, and it climbs to $63,280 for the limited-run A91-CF Edition.
